When considering retirement, do you wonder what financial opportunities you may be missing? Busy lives take over and years pass without taking advantage. In this retirement podcast, the Financial Symmetry advisors unveil financial opportunities, to help you balance enjoying today so you are ready to retire later. By day, they are fiduciary fee-only financial advisors who answer questions about tax savings, investment decisions, and how to save more.     Tax planning often slips to the bottom of our financial to-do lists—until a surprise bill or missed opportunity crops up. But behind the scenes, the right process for an ongoing tax strategy can put you leagues ahead, reducing uncertainty and helping you capitalize on changes. On the show this week, we’ll walk through the seven stages of tax planning, highlighting key insights and practical actions you can take.

    Planning for retirement isn't just about hitting your savings targets and hoping for the best. It's about getting creative, asking new questions, and challenging your own assumptions.

    We follow the retirement planning journey of a fictional couple, Dwight and Angela, who are three to five years from retirement, using the SIFT framework shared by Rohit Bhargava and Ben duPont in their book “Non-Obvious Thinking”, to shed light on hidden financial opportunities.

    Planning for your child’s college education can feel overwhelming, especially when faced with skyrocketing tuition costs and countless savings options. This week on the show, we’re discussing the question of exactly how much you should save in a 529 college savings plan.
